Liftwise Simulator — Runbook Fragment

The dispatch simulator replays elevator call patterns against the candidate scheduler and compares wait-time percentiles with the baseline. Runs are deterministic given the same seed, so reruns are cheap. If a run stalls, check the tick-rate setting first; an overly aggressive value starves the comparison worker. Restarts are safe mid-run since state checkpoints every simulated hour. For this week's sync, the relevant run used the configuration below.

settings of bawif-fawif:
ralix:
  log_level: warn
  metrics_host: metrics.ralix.tolvaqsys.internal
  pool_size: 32

**Mgmt Meeting Minutes — Retiring the Brightline Range**

Quick recap for sales leads at Fenholt Supplies: we agreed to retire the Brightline fixture range by year-end. Remaining stock moves to clearance pricing next month, and accounts on standing orders get migrated to the Lumetta range. Trade-in incentives were approved in principle. The confidential note on next steps sits just below.

board note of bajof-bajeg: The pricing group signed off on a budget of $13.4 million for Project Sildor. The renewal with Lamixek Holdings closes at $48.9 million a year, 49 percent above the last contract.

Step 4: Ship the CSV Import Wizard

Welcome aboard! Once your branch merges into main, the Quillbrook pipeline builds the import wizard bundle automatically. Double-check the column-mapping presets in the staging console first — new folks always forget that step, and Marisol will gently remind you forever. When the smoke tests pass, you're ready to push to production. The release artifact has to be signed before the gate will accept it, so grab the key below and you're set.

deploy key for kajof-fajop: bky6_gDHw9Q

Handover: Spreadsheet export on Quillbase still spikes memory when rows exceed 200k; I capped the streaming buffer at 64MB and moved chunking into the Veldt worker pool. Tarek, watch heap metrics after the 3.2 cut. Release notes draft is in the shared folder. To unlock the export staging vault, use the recovery passphrase below.

unlock words, bahop-fawef: novmir-druwyn-soriel-rusdor-kasion